Visitors robbed on East Coast

POLICE ARE INVESTIGATING another aggravated robbery in Barbados.

And this time it involved visitors to the island.

The cops started a manhunt for an armed assailant who robbed a four-member Canadian family as they were enjoying the conditions off Barbados’ picturesque East Coast.

The man, his wife and two children had a number of electronic items stolen by the gun-carrying perpetrator, as they were hanging out near Barclays Park, along the Ermie Bourne Highway in St Joseph just before noon today.

None of the family was injured during the incident. (BA)
